WINTER J/70 COACHING PROGRAM

Monthly coached training sessions, followed by short fleet racing.

Coach TBA

Session 1, Sat 23 May 2026 - Boat set up, launching and rigging, on water training

Session 2, Sat 20 June 2026 - Crew roles and three sails tuning; racing

Session 3, Sat 4 July 2026 - Boat handling; racing

Session 4, Sat 1 Aug 2026 - Boat speed and finer rigging; racing

Session 5, Sat 12 Sept 2026 - Sprint series racing

 

Session 1 timing - 11:30-3:00 

Sessions 2-5 timing - 10.15 briefing, 10.30 program start, 12:00 training session ends, lunch on water, 12:30 race start, 14:30 pack up, 15:00 debrief

Participants must commit to attending at least 3 sessions throughout the program. We'd love to see you at all five. During registration, you'll be asked to nominate the sessions you are available to attend.

This program includes skipper and crew positions on board the three BYS J/70s and joining existing J70 teams from the Blairgowrie fleet.
